6 Arrested in Kerala: The Kerala Police filed two FIRs and arrested six individuals after an 18-year-old Dalit girl from Pathanamthitta district accused around 62 persons of sexually assaulting her for the past five years.
According to Pathanamthitta Superintendent of Police V G Vinod Kumar, two cases were registered in different police station. "In one case we arrested five people and a lone accused in another case. Other case will be registered once details are verified. The probe is being supervised by a deputy superintendent of police," he added.

The case emerged after volunteers of Kerala Mahila Samakhya Society during a random visit to a district level athlete girl met her. When she was going to narrate her bitter experiences for past year these volunteers informed the district Child Welfare Committee (CWC).
Advocate N Rajeev, who heads the Pathanamthitta CWC, said it actually has come before the committee 15 days ago. “I told the girl to report before the committee along with her mother. She was given counselling and she opened up before a psychologist, narrating the sexual abuse she has been facing since the age of 13.”
He said that the family of the girl did not know about the alleged sexual abuses that went on for years. “She hadn’t shared anything with the mother. Since the girl is a district-level athlete, she has attended various sports camps over the years. That situation might have facilitated this series of sexual abuse,” he added.

“She used the mobile phone of her father, an alcoholic. Most of the perpetrators were identified from the list of contacts in the mobile phone. Many numbers were found saved in it,” Rajeev said.
“Psychologists with the Nirbhaya scheme spoke to her to ascertain the credibility of her claims. They also examined her father’s mobile phone to find out the names of the alleged abusers. Once the probe progresses, the chances of involvement of more people cannot be ruled out,” he said, adding, “The girl has been shifted to a shelter under the CWC, considering her protection.”
